【mysql导出某个表 mysql按照表导出数据】导读:
MySQL是一种关系型数据库管理系统 , 它可以帮助用户存储、管理和检索数据 。在使用MySQL时,我们通常需要将数据导出到其他地方进行处理或备份 。本文将介绍如何按照表导出MySQL的数据 。
步骤:
1. 打开MySQL命令行工具
2. 连接到要导出数据的数据库
3. 使用SELECT语句查询要导出的数据
4. 将查询结果保存为CSV文件或SQL文件
详细说明:
在Windows环境下,可以通过“开始”菜单中的“运行”命令打开命令行工具 。在Linux环境下,可以通过终端窗口打开命令行工具 。
在命令行工具中输入以下命令 , 以连接到指定的数据库:
mysql -u 用户名 -p 密码 数据库名称
其中,用户名和密码分别是你的MySQL账户和密码 , 数据库名称是你要导出数据的数据库名称 。
在连接到数据库后,可以使用SELECT语句查询需要导出的数据 。例如,查询一个名为“users”的表中所有用户的信息,可以输入以下命令:
SELECT * FROM users;
在查询结果显示出来后 , 可以将其保存为CSV文件或SQL文件 。如果要将查询结果保存为CSV文件,可以使用以下命令:
SELECT * INTO OUTFILE '文件路径' FIELDS TERMINATED BY ',' OPTIONALLY ENCLOSED BY '"' LINES TERMINATED BY '\n' FROM users;
其中 , “文件路径”是要保存的CSV文件的路径和文件名 。
如果要将查询结果保存为SQL文件 , 可以使用以下命令:
mysqldump -u 用户名 -p 密码 数据库名称 表名称 > 文件路径
其中 , “表名称”是要导出数据的表的名称,“文件路径”是要保存的SQL文件的路径和文件名 。
总结:
MySQL是一种强大的数据库管理系统,可以帮助用户存储、管理和检索数据 。按照表导出MySQL的数据可以方便地备份数据或将其导入其他地方进行处理 。通过本文介绍的方法,您可以轻松地将MySQL表中的数据导出为CSV文件或SQL文件,以满足各种需求 。
推荐阅读
- mysql如何执行sql mysql语句怎么执行
- 如何拆开云服务器硬盘进行检查? 云服务器硬盘怎么拆开看
- redis应用场景及实现 redis应用实践
- redis的setifabsent redis的set
- rediscli 密码 redis-trib密码
- mysql+redis mysql读入redis
- redis缓存项目 redis服务中行情缓存
- redis一般用来做什么 redis用来干什么
- 查询数据库时间 查询数据库redis